分布式追踪在社交领域的应用:优化用户互动体验
随着互联网技术的不断发展,社交平台已经成为人们日常生活中不可或缺的一部分。在社交领域,用户互动体验的优化对于平台的发展至关重要。而分布式追踪作为一种强大的技术手段,在社交领域的应用已经越来越广泛。本文将从分布式追踪在社交领域的应用入手,探讨其如何优化用户互动体验。
一、分布式追踪概述
分布式追踪是指通过追踪和分析分布式系统中各个组件的运行状态,实现对整个系统的监控、优化和故障定位。在社交领域,分布式追踪主要应用于以下三个方面:
用户行为分析:通过对用户在社交平台上的行为轨迹进行追踪,了解用户兴趣、需求,从而实现个性化推荐。
系统性能监控:实时监控社交平台的运行状态,及时发现并解决系统性能瓶颈,提高用户体验。
故障定位与优化:在系统出现故障时,快速定位问题所在,并进行优化,确保平台稳定运行。
二、分布式追踪在社交领域的应用
- 个性化推荐
在社交领域,个性化推荐是提高用户互动体验的关键。通过分布式追踪,可以实现对用户行为数据的实时采集和分析,为用户提供更加精准的推荐内容。
具体应用如下:
(1)用户画像:通过追踪用户在社交平台上的行为,如点赞、评论、分享等,构建用户画像,了解用户兴趣和偏好。
(2)推荐算法:根据用户画像,运用推荐算法为用户推荐感兴趣的内容,提高用户活跃度和满意度。
(3)实时调整:根据用户反馈和互动数据,实时调整推荐策略,优化用户体验。
- 系统性能监控
社交平台的高并发特性要求系统具备强大的性能。分布式追踪可以帮助监控系统性能,及时发现并解决性能瓶颈。
具体应用如下:
(1)资源监控:实时监控服务器、网络等资源的使用情况,确保系统稳定运行。
(2)性能指标分析:分析关键性能指标,如响应时间、并发量等,为优化系统性能提供依据。
(3)故障预警:通过异常检测和报警机制,提前发现潜在故障,避免影响用户体验。
- 故障定位与优化
在社交领域,故障定位和优化对于保障平台稳定运行至关重要。分布式追踪可以帮助快速定位故障原因,并进行优化。
具体应用如下:
(1)故障追踪:通过追踪故障发生时的系统状态,快速定位故障原因。
(2)日志分析:分析故障日志,了解故障发生的原因和影响范围。
(3)优化方案:根据故障原因,制定优化方案,提高系统稳定性。
三、总结
分布式追踪在社交领域的应用,为优化用户互动体验提供了有力支持。通过追踪用户行为、监控系统性能和定位故障,分布式追踪可以帮助社交平台实现个性化推荐、提高系统稳定性和保障用户体验。未来,随着分布式追踪技术的不断发展,其在社交领域的应用将更加广泛,为用户带来更加优质的服务。
猜你喜欢:可观测性平台